noun Chemistry, Physics.
a transuranic element produced in nuclear reactors by the neutron bombardment of U-238: decays rapidly to plutonium and then to U-235. Symbol: Np; atomic number: 93.

British Dictionary definitions for neptunium
neptunium
/ (nÉpË?tjuË?nɪÉm) /
noun
a silvery metallic transuranic element synthesized in the production of plutonium and occurring in trace amounts in uranium ores. Symbol: Np; atomic no: 93; half-life of most stable isotope, 237 Np: 2.14 Ã 10 6 years; valency: 3, 4, 5, or 6; relative density: 20.25; melting pt: 639±1°C; boiling pt: 3902°C (est)
Word Origin for neptunium
C20: from Neptune ², the planet beyond Uranus, because neptunium is the element beyond uranium in the periodic table

Scientific definitions for neptunium
neptunium
[ nÄp-tÅÅâ²nÄ-Ém ]
Np
A silvery, radioactive metallic element of the actinide series. It occurs naturally in minute amounts in uranium ores and is produced artificially as a byproduct of plutonium production. Its longest-lived isotope is Np 237 with a half-life of 2.1 million years. Atomic number 93. See Periodic Table.
